Presentation
History of head trauma seven days ago. The patient's conscious status altered for last two days.
Patient Data
Age: 7 years
Gender: Male

Evidence of multiple hemorrhagic foci in bilateral cerebral gray-white matter junction as well as in the splenium of corpus callosum.
Case Discussion
The features are suggestive of diffuse axonal injury grade II.
